Investigation of Grey Cast Iron Water Mains to Develop a Methodology for Estimating Service Life by Balvant Rajani,AWWA Research Foundation Pdf

The principal objective of this research project was to develop a methodology that would assist water distribution engineers estimating the optimum time to replace grey cast iron water mains. The methodology should integrate information on corrosion-induced pit dimensions, effective pipe wall thickness, residual strength of grey cast iron, corrosion rates and the mechanical behavior of metallic water mains. Secondary objectives within the project were: to determine the most effective and practical approaches to measure the residual strength of grey cast iron pipe; to determine whether current or near-term nondestructive testing technology could be used to produce the necessary information on corrosion put dimensions; and to expand the current state of knowledge with respect to the mechanical behaviour of grey cast iron water mains.

Many water utilities have only a limited knowledge of the structural condition of their underground assests. In order to maintain optimum serviceability, it is increasingly important that utilities gain a better understanding of the current condition and performance of these buried assets. Regular inspection and condition assessment of pipelines can greatly assist utilities with developing robust and cost-effective operational maintenance programs, which will optimize capital expenditure whilst minimizing risk. The aim of the project was to conduct a state-of-the-art literature review of non-interruptive condition assessment inspection devices for large diameter transmission mains (greater than 12 inches). In addition, an expert panel workshop was to be held to review business needs and drivers, the performance of existing technologies, and future underground asset condition assessment research needs. Ductile iron pipe (DIP) was introduced about 50 years ago as a more economical and better-performing product for water transmission and distribution. As with iron or steel pipes, DIP is subject to corrosion, the rate of which depends on the environment in which the pipe is placed. Corrosion mitigation protocols are employed to slow the corrosion process to an acceptable rate for the application. When to use corrosion mitigation systems, and which system, depends on the corrosivity of the soils in which the pipeline is buried. The Bureau of Reclamation's specification for DIP in highly corrosive soil has been contested by some as an overly stringent requirement, necessitating the pipe to be modified from its as-manufactured state and thereby adding unnecessary cost to a pipeline system. This book evaluates the specifications in question and presents findings and recommendations. Specifically, the authoring committee answers the following questions: Does polyethylene encasement with cathodic protection work on ductile iron pipe installed in highly corrosive soils? Will polyethylene encasement and cathodic protection reliably provide a minimum service life of 50 years? What possible alternative corrosion mitigation methods for DIP would provide a service life of 50 years?
